Munich Hauptbahnhof

Munich Hauptbahnhof, or Munich Central Station, is the main railway hub in Munich, Germany. Opened in 1840, it serves as a key transportation link within the city and across Europe. The station features numerous platforms for regional, national, and international trains, making it one of the busiest rail stations in the world. In addition to train services, it offers various shops, restaurants, and services, making it a bustling center for travelers. Its central location provides easy access to Munich's attractions, enhancing connectivity for both locals and visitors.
